Convert generate-sysdig-event.py to Python 3. Update it to fetch from the current version of Sysdig (0.26.1). Add logic to work around mismatched parameter counts and mismatched types and formats. '''\
|
|
Generate Sysdig event dissector sections from the sysdig sources.
|
|
|
|
Reads driver/event_table.c and driver/ppm_events_public.h and generates
|
|
corresponding dissection code in packet-sysdig-event.c. Updates are
|
|
performed in-place in the dissector code.
|
|
|
|
Requires an Internet connection. Assets are loaded from GitHub over HTTPS.
|
|
'''
